    im·pugn
    [imˈpyo͞on]
    verb
    impugn (verb) · impugns (third person present) · impugned (past tense) · impugned (past participle) · impugning (present participle)
    1. dispute the truth, validity, or honesty of (a statement or motive); call into question:
      "the father does not impugn her capacity as a good mother"
    Origin
    late Middle English (also in the sense ‘assault, attack physically’): from Latin impugnare ‘assail’, from in- ‘towards’ + pugnare ‘fight’.
